A suspect involved in a Virginia house explosion is believed to be dead, according to Arlington County Police. The suspect, identified as 56-year-old James Yoo, was the subject of a search warrant at the time of the explosion.

Arlington County Police have confirmed that the suspect involved in an explosion at a house in Virginia on Monday night is presumed dead. The suspect has been identified as 56-year-old James Yoo. The explosion occurred while officers were executing a search warrant at the residence.

The incident took place in Arlington County, Virginia, and it has left the community in shock. The explosion caused significant damage to the property and nearby surroundings. It is fortunate that there were no reported injuries to law enforcement officers or any other individuals in the vicinity at the time of the explosion.

The motive behind the search warrant and the subsequent explosion remains unclear. Law enforcement officials are conducting a thorough investigation to determine the cause and circumstances of the incident.
